Early Life and Education

Ballmer was born in 1956 in Detroit, Michigan, and showed an early interest in business and numbers. He attended Harvard University, where he studied mathematics and economics. While at Harvard, he met Bill Gates and chose to leave before graduating to join the founding team of a small software company that would become Microsoft.

Microsoft Career and CEO Tenure

Ballmer joined Microsoft in 1980 in a key operations role and held several leadership positions before becoming CEO in January 2000. His tenure as CEO lasted through February 2014. During this period, Microsoft expanded its enterprise software reach, launched major products and services, and faced significant antitrust and competitive challenges. Key highlights include:

Enterprise and Cloud Direction

Under Ballmer, Microsoft strengthened its enterprise offerings, expanded server and tools businesses, and laid groundwork for cloud adoption. While cloud momentum accelerated after his tenure, these years established the foundation for later Azure growth. The company pursued scale across Office, Dynamics, and server platforms, emphasizing long-term enterprise relationships.

Post-Microsoft Work and Civic Engagement

After leaving Microsoft, Ballmer focused on civic initiatives, philanthropy, and ownership of a major sports franchise. His post-Microsoft activities center on data-driven analysis of social and economic trends, public education, and public finance.

Owner of the Los Angeles Clippers

In 2014, Ballmer led a group that acquired the Los Angeles Clippers. The ownership group committed to significant investment in the team, facilities, and community programs. Under his ownership, the franchise has emphasized performance, transparency, and long-term planning.

Civic and Philanthropic Initiatives

Ballmer launched an expanded scope of civic work focused on data, measurable outcomes, and public policy. His contributions emphasize clear metrics and public accessibility. Examples include funding for public education analysis and government finance transparency tools.

Leadership Style and Management Approach

Ballmer was known for an energetic, direct leadership style, frequent town halls, and clear articulation of company goals. He emphasized operational rigor, competitive benchmarking, and accountability. These traits shaped Microsoft’s culture during a period of intense innovation and rivalry in technology.
